| Резюме: | VIII. SUMMARY This research was conducted in the Struts community Bajo, Canton Bolivar, Bolivar parish in the province of Carchi. The area is located 008'29,92 "north latitude, 77042'35" west latitude and at an altitude of 2600 meters. The area has climatic characteristics with annual averages of humid temperate climate with average annual temperature of 14 0C and a relative humidity of 81%. Mashua seed tubers (Tropaeoleum tuberosum) from black variety of the study area were used. The objectives were to evaluate the effect of soil and fertilization bioestimulantes agronomic performance culture mashua, determine the appropriate dose of fertilizer for growing and economically analyze treatments. The treatments were composed by doses of soil based fertilizers Nitrogen, phosphorus and potassium in doses of 120-300-240; 80-200-160; 40-100-160 kg / ha and bioestimulantes Bio-Stim, Bio-Bio-Energy Zime and more an absolute control. Design Randomized Complete Block (DBCA) with ten treatments and three replications was used. Comparisons of averages were carried out by testing ranges Duncan minimum 5% probability. Crop development for the preparatory work of the experimental field, delimitation of the plots, planting, fertilizing, weeding and hoeing, foliar application of bio-stimulants, irrigation, pest and disease control and harvesting were made. To estimate the effects of treatment data germination percentage, days to flowering, plant length, days to maturity, performance by category and economic analysis were evaluated. For the results presented, it was determined that the doses of soil fertilizer, combined with three bioestimulantes favorable results in crop yield mashua (Tropaeolum tuberosum); all treatments obtained excellent germination percentage; the absolute control was the treatment that took to blossom and mature; the application of 40 kg / ha of N + 100 kg / ha of P + 160 kg / ha of K with bioestimulante Bio - Zime reported longer plant at 60 and 90 days and the increased crop yield and net profit as got the application of 40 kg / ha of N + 100 kg / ha of P + 160 kg / ha of K using the Bio-Energy bioestimulante 17333.3 kg / ha and $ 5603.89. |
